Description

目錄
第一回 秦瓊破登州 夜打金鎖城
第二回 楊令差羅舟 濟南解秦瓊
第三回 黃桑店歇宿 史大奈為王
第四回 瓦崗寨聚會 暗進登州城
第五回 銀安殿比武 楊老令慊敵
第六回 靠山王點將 大擺八卦陣
第七回 徐茂公出令 暗排八宮陣
第八回 演武庭對棒 活挾小楊安
第九回 松林點信火 咬金戰隋將
第十回 君可射中軍 伯當拔撤同
第十一回 羅舟救叔寶 羅成刺楊令
第十二回 怒拿呼雷豹 斷山同歇馬
第十三回 羅配送幽州 秦瓊回濟南
第十四回 鐵打蕭國舅 解脫梁都堂
第十五回 瓦崗寨聚義 程咬金稱王
第十六回 白虎羅士信 大戰老楊令
第十七回 火焚斷山寨 靠山王下書
第十八回 押解梁都堂 路遇秦叔寶
第十九回 殺戰紫微營 同奔瓦崗寨
第二十回 程咬金為王 大封眾兄弟
第二十一回 靠山王點兵 兵困瓦崗寨
第二十二回 淄川羅士信 二奪呼雷豹
